About

Jon M. Pinnick has over 27 years of legal experience focused on representing physicians, dentists, podiatrists, and osteopaths in medical malpractice litigation. He has taken more than 40 jury trials to verdict as lead counsel, with a strong record of defense verdicts in complex, high-stakes cases throughout Indiana courts.

Jon began his academic journey at Hanover College, earning a B.A.S. in Economics in 1987. He graduated as a Presidential Scholar, Academic and Athletic All-American, and a member of the Mortar Board Honor Society. He then earned his J.D. from Indiana University School of Law in 1990, establishing a solid foundation for a distinguished litigation career.

Jon’s legal practice centers on medical malpractice, healthcare litigation, medical licensing board actions, and general litigation. He is admitted to practice in all Indiana state courts, the Northern and Southern Federal District Courts, and the Seventh Circuit Court of Appeals. He has also argued numerous cases at both the Indiana Court of Appeals and the Seventh Circuit.

Jon is a frequent speaker on medical-legal issues, presenting to healthcare providers and attorneys in continuing legal education programs. His deep understanding of clinical standards and courtroom procedures makes him a trusted advisor and skilled advocate for healthcare professionals facing litigation.

Jon is a member of the Defense Research Institute and the Defense Trial Counsel of Indiana. He has consistently demonstrated excellence in securing favorable outcomes through jury verdicts, summary judgments, and appellate rulings. His success reflects not only litigation expertise but also his ability to navigate highly technical medical facts.
